The roots of the Millennium Steel joint venture date back 12-1/2 years to a meeting between Toyota and Henry Jackson. Jackson was then president and CEO of Jackson Plastics Inc., a plastic injection molder in Nicholasville, Ky., and a Tier I and II supplier to Toyota, as well as other auto and appliance makers. This resulted in a Minority Owned Joint Venture with Toyota Tsusho America Inc. called Millennium Steel Service, LLC. Millennium Steel Service, LLC is a Tier 1 Raw Material supplier to Toyota and other Toyota related parts makers for one of the most important commodities needed to manufacture automobiles, Steel. Millennium Steel is responsible for all logistical aspects of the steel supply chain including ordering, purchasing, processing, warehousing and delivery of steel. Toyota as a customer demands a very high standard of quality, delivery (Just in Time) and Service (order accuracy, ability to respond to crises etc.). MSS has been proud to report 100% acheivement of the quality, delivery and service targets across its customers for the past 5 years.
